It is with great sadness that I inform my fellow RVators that William (Bill) Riggs passed away Saturday morning (4/17/10) at his home after a yearlong battle with cancer. Bill was a professional pilot that learned to fly at 18 and flew for USAir for 30 years. 2 years ago, after seeing what fun others of us were having with our RV-6?s at Louisa field, Bill sold his C-180 to buy Robbie Attaway?s purple hot rod RV-6. Bill?s ?6 made us a ?Flight of Four?. Being the Captain and CFII, Bill was the guy that kept us straight and was always quick with the tips to be better pilots and sign our log books after BFR flights .
Bill really enjoyed the ?Fun Flying? that brings RV-Grins to all our faces. He didn?t let the fact he had the fastest RV around go un-noticed, in a joking kind of way and didn?t hesitate to throttle back once we asked! I can easily say he made me a better pilot for knowing him and will surely be remembered on every lunch fly-out. Blue Skies Bill !!
